Stage eight.

 

I attached the head onto the neck with more epoxy. Then I built up the neck muscles the same way I did the torso and arm muscles. However in this case, I covered everything with latex, thickened with cabosil. I spatulated this on, and sculpted the muscle detail directly into the latex. The muscles on the exposed side of the head were sculpted in a thin layer of the epoxy. (Tricky!) Then I coated the torso with red tinted latex and roughed it up and peeled it to look like peeling layers of tissue. (If you look at a medical book, there’s a LOT of layers of tissue.)
